Two page leaflet supporting the Yes vote in the 1967 Referendum to amend the constitution to include Aboriginal people in the census and allow the Federal government to create laws for them. The leaflet was "authorised by Mrs. Kath Walker, Qld. Secretary, Federal Council for Advancement of Aborigines and Torres Strait Islanders (FCAA) and Secretary, Qld. Council for the Advancement of Aborigines and Torres Islanders (QCAATI)."
